Attention attention San Francisco residents who have not pre-ordered the G1, we have news for you! Sadly the news is only good if you live in that in the San Fran area as T-mobile has chosen the San Francisco store at 3rd and Market St to start selling G1′s a day early. You read that right, at 6pm local time (6pm PDT) you will be able able to purchase the G1 and be the envy of all your friends. We imagine that they have limited inventory and high demand so go early and go with a friend, the buddy system works better for bathroom breaks!

If you aren’t in San Francisco or have already received your pre-ordered phone, don’t worry because your wait only extends one more day. In the meantime, head over to the forums and try not to be jealous of everyone already showing their phones off.
